2006 Town Warrant Article 12
Shall the Town vote to raise and appropriate the sum of $136,118.00 to place all employees not already covered by Social Security, Medicare, and NH Retirement into those programs? (Recommended by Selectmen) (Recommended by Budget Committee)

Voter's Guide Explanation
Of the 67 full time employees of the town, currently 28 are not enrolled in Social Security or Medicare. This is due to decisions made when participation in these programs was optional. The town is still “grandfathered” in the self funded program and offers no other retirement program to these employees. Adoption of this Article would allow all employees to become eligible for Social Security and Medicare. Additionally, employees who are not already covered by the NH Retirement System (any non Police or Fire personnel) would be eligible to participate in the retirement program.
